X-ray diffraction studies on solution-grown LiKSO<sub>4</sub> have been performed between 70 K and 300 K. The lattice parameters have been obtained as a function of the temperature. The hexagonal to trigonal phase transition at 205 K is seen by a slight increase of the c lattice parameter, while the ferroelastic transition at 182 K is accompanied by the appearance of an important spontaneous elastic deformation. The deformation and the domain pattern are analysed via a 'squeezing' model of the hexagonal lattice which leads to a monoclinic lattice below T<sub>c</sub>=182 K.
